I liked this marketing initiative by Levi's. Many brands are taking up cause marketing: I think it's a move in the right direction. However, what do you do when a product you don't like has great marketing and one that you like doesn't? (I prefer Lee jeans.)

For another example, I loved Hippo's ads when I first saw them on TV. I love their message: the idea that hunger is the root of all ills is simplistic and naive but so optimistic. And they've done a great job with having a distinct, interesting voice. But I wouldn't eat their snacks unless I was really hungry and there was nothing else in sight.
